Direct Bluetooth Connection
Samsung TVs, particularly newer models, often boast built-in Bluetooth capabilities. This means you might be able to connect your earbuds directly to your TV for a private listening experience. However, not all Samsung TVs support Bluetooth audio output, so it’s essential to check your TV’s specifications first.
Checking for Bluetooth Support
To determine if your Samsung TV has Bluetooth functionality, look for a Bluetooth icon in the TV’s settings menu. You can usually access this menu by pressing the “Menu” button on your TV remote. If you see a Bluetooth option, your TV is Bluetooth-enabled.
Pairing Your Earbuds
Once you confirm Bluetooth support, follow these general steps to pair your earbuds with your Samsung TV:
Put your earbuds in pairing mode. Consult your earbuds’ manual for specific instructions on how to do this, as the process can vary between models.
Navigate to the Bluetooth settings on your Samsung TV and select “Add Device” or a similar option.
Your TV should begin searching for nearby Bluetooth devices. Make sure your earbuds are within range and still in pairing mode.
Select your earbuds from the list of available devices on your TV screen. You may need to enter a PIN code, which is usually “0000” or displayed on your earbuds.
Troubleshooting Tips
If you encounter issues pairing your earbuds, try the following:
Ensure both your earbuds and TV are powered on and within range of each other.
Restart both your TV and earbuds.
Remove any existing Bluetooth connections on your TV and try pairing again.
Check your earbuds’ manual for specific troubleshooting tips.
Alternative Connection Methods
If your Samsung TV doesn’t support Bluetooth audio output, or if you encounter pairing issues, consider these alternative connection methods:
Using a Bluetooth Transmitter
A Bluetooth transmitter can bridge the gap between your TV and your earbuds. These devices plug into your TV’s audio output jack (usually 3.5mm) and then transmit the audio wirelessly to your earbuds via Bluetooth.
Optical Audio Cable
Some Samsung TVs have an optical audio output port. You can connect this port to a Bluetooth receiver that then transmits the audio to your earbuds.

Connecting Wired Earbuds to Your Samsung TV
The Basics: 3.5mm Audio Jack
Many Samsung TVs, particularly older models, come equipped with a 3.5mm audio jack. This standard port allows you to directly connect wired earbuds using a standard audio cable. Simply plug one end of the cable into the headphone jack on your TV and the other end into your earbuds.
It’s worth noting that the 3.5mm port might be labeled as “Headphone” or “Audio Out.”
Finding the Audio Jack
The location of the 3.5mm audio jack varies depending on your Samsung TV model.
- Rear Panel: The most common location is on the back or side of the TV, often near the HDMI and USB ports.
- Side Panel: Some TVs have the audio jack positioned on one of the sides.
Troubleshooting Connection Issues
If you’re experiencing trouble connecting your earbuds, try these steps:
- Check the Cable: Ensure the audio cable is securely plugged into both the TV and earbuds. A loose connection can prevent sound from passing through.
- Inspect the Jack: Look for any debris or damage in the audio jack on your TV. Use a can of compressed air to gently remove any dust or dirt.
- Adjust TV Settings: Navigate to your TV’s audio settings and confirm that the output is set to “Headphone” or “Audio Out.”
- Try Different Earbuds: If possible, test with a different pair of wired earbuds to rule out a problem with your earbuds themselves.

What if my earbuds aren’t showing up on my Samsung TV’s Bluetooth list?
If your earbuds aren’t appearing, ensure they are in pairing mode. This usually involves holding down a button on the earbuds until they flash or blink. Check the Bluetooth range, as earbuds typically have a limited connection distance. Also, make sure your TV’s Bluetooth is enabled and that there are no other Bluetooth devices interfering with the connection. Restarting both your TV and earbuds might also resolve the issue.
